### Audit Item 14 — String Extraction Script

Confirm the Quillmark translation-string extraction script ran against the release branch and that the output catalog matches the shipped bundle. Missing keys block release. Check the extraction log for skipped files and verify none are user-facing. Release manager signs only after reviewing the diff against the prior catalog. Script ownership belongs to the maintainer named below.

named custodian: Brivan Eliath Quenox Frador

- [ ] **Step 7: Breaker override escrow.** After sealing the signing keys for the Tallgrove upstream API circuit breaker, confirm the support team can force the breaker open during a full outage. The override bundle lives in the sealed escrow drawer and is useless without its unlock phrase. Two ceremony witnesses must initial this step before proceeding. The escrow bundle is decrypted with the recovery passphrase that follows.

vault phrase of kahip-kahop = holath-quenmir

# Approvals: Cron-to-Flowhinge Migration

All cron jobs moving to the Flowhinge workflow engine need approval before cutover. Submit the job spec, retry policy, and rollback plan. On-call may pause any migrated workflow without approval; resuming requires one. Batch migrations capped at five per week. All approvals go through the person below.

account owner for bawip-tahag: Raleth Quenok

**Ledger Archiving — Transport Notes**

Paper ledgers from the Dunmoor branch go to the Aldercote records vault quarterly. Records team: box by fiscal year, seal with numbered tape, list contents on the lid. Max four boxes per run. Carrier is Stonewick Transit, Thursdays. No loose volumes. At the vault dock, the driver completes hand-over per the confidential line below.

handover note for yagef-bagep: the drudor pelius courier leaves the kasdor zorvan norir ledger at gate 8016 under passcode 755406